The ingredients needed to make Zero oil Chicken Masala Gravy:
  1. Make ready For marination
  2. Take 1/2 kg chicken
  3. Make ready 1 cup curd
  4. Get 1/2 tsp turmeric powder
  5. Prepare 1/2 tsp fennel seeds
  6. Prepare 1 tsp Garam masala
  7. Make ready 1 tsp coriander powder
  8. Get 1 tsp cumin powder
  9. Take 1 tsp red chilli powder
  10. Take 1 tbsp Ginger garlic paste
  11. Take 1/2 tsp Pav bhaji masala
  12. Take 1/2 onion finely chopped
  13. Prepare To taste Salt
  14. Get 2 tbsp semolina (dry roasted)
  15. Take 2 tbsp chopped coriander leaves
  16. Make ready For Grinding
  17. Make ready 1/2 onion sliced
  18. Take 2 medium size tomatoes chopped
  19. Make ready 1 bay leaf
  20. Take 2 green cardamom
  21. Prepare 1 small cinnamon stick
  22. Prepare 4-5 black pepper
  23. Prepare 3-4 cloves
  24. Take 1 green chilli chopped
  25. Get 2 tbsp chopped coriander leaves
  26. Prepare 3 spinach leaves
  27. Make ready 1 tsp white sesame seeds
  28. Take 1 tsp cumin seeds
  29. Get 1/4 tsp carom seeds
  30. Prepare 1/2 lemon juice
  31. Prepare 1/4 cup coconut water
  32. Prepare 3 tbsp finely chopped fresh coconut
  33. Take 5-6 curry leaves
  34. Make ready 6 dried red chilli
  35. Prepare 1 tbsp roasted gram dal (putani)
  36. Take As needed Water
  37. Prepare For gravy
  38. Get 1 tbsp chicken masala powder
  39. Take 2 cup or required water
  40. Prepare 2 tsp Chopped coriander leaves for garnish
  41. Prepare to taste Salt according
Instructions to make Zero oil Chicken Masala Gravy:
  1. Firstly take the large mixing bowl add washed chicken, dry roasted semolina, and all masala ingredients above mentioned in marination.
  2. Next combine well together, cover and rest it for half an hour.
  3. Now heat the nonstick pan put bay leaf, cardamom, cinnamon, cloves, black pepper, cumin and sesame seeds dry roast till they becomes lightly aromatic smell.
  4. Further add sliced onions, chopped tomatoes, and dried red chillies to it saute for few seconds.
  5. Next immediately add water mix well. Then cover and cook for until all water disappear or absorbed. Off the flame and keep it side at room temperature.
  6. Once cooled completely then transfer to grinder or mixer jar, additionally add roughly chopped spinach, Green chilli chopped, coriander leaves, chopped coconut, curry leaves, roasted gram dal, carom seeds, coconut water and lemon juice.
  7. Add water if needed, then grind to make smooth paste. Keep it aside
  8. Heat the pan on medium flame, and place the marinated chicken stir for 30 seconds, then add grinded mixture, water, and salt to taste (remember already salt adding marination time also) mix well. Add more water If u needed
  9. Cover and cook until the chicken is well cooked. Stir occasionally in between time, After few mins add chicken masala powder saute again.
  10. Furthermore check the cookness and gravy consistency. lastly add chopped coriander leaves.
  11. Finally zero oil chicken masala Gravy is ready. serve hot with rice, roti, chapati etc
